Output d95cf002c3eb5b7df2e1e7bb2ea03d834eb1f8530f7519d3fa6445141a10b024:0

value
6164383
script pubkey
OP_0 OP_PUSHBYTES_20 57d20eda61523b62089d1f141721fac15ca0be77
address
bc1q2lfqaknp2gakyzyaru2pwg06c9w2p0nh7stqzr
transaction
d95cf002c3eb5b7df2e1e7bb2ea03d834eb1f8530f7519d3fa6445141a10b024
confirmations
16901
spent
true